Merchandise Return
Merchandise Return is the process by which a customer returns previously purchased goods back to the seller, typically due to issues like defects or dissatisfaction.
Discount Period
The timeframe in which a buyer can take advantage of a discount for early payment on money owed.
Cost of Goods Purchased
The total expense incurred in buying goods for sale, including any additional costs necessary to get them into a saleable state.
Goods Purchased
Items bought by a business for the purpose of resale, production, or as part of its services.
